At Ty Croes station, simplicity is key, and travelers should plan ahead as amenities are minimal. There is no ticket office or ticket machine available for purchasing or collecting train tickets, so it's advisable to book tickets online and make use of digital options. Accessibility enhancements include step-free access to both platforms and an induction loop for those requiring hearing assistance. However, there are no provisions for bicycle storage or waiting rooms, though there is a seating area available for those seeking a moment of rest before their journey.
While the station does not offer ample parking, there is free car parking available in the vicinity. It's worth noting, though, that there are no CCTV cameras, so parking is at the owner's discretion. Access to nearby transport links is also relatively straightforward with a rail replacement bus stop conveniently located at the station entrance. Congleton Station offers a range of amenities to enhance your travel experience. Although it doesn't have a waiting room, there is ample seating available. For ticket purchases or collections, a ticket office is available from Monday to Saturday with opening hours from 06:30 to 13:40 during weekdays and a slightly later start on Saturday. Alternatively, you'll find ticket machines on site, complete with an induction loop for those with hearing aids. Smartcards can also be issued and validated at the station. While there's no staffed footbridge, step-free access is available to both the Manchester and Stoke platforms, making it a scooter-friendly location. CCTV is in operation for your safety.
Congleton Station ensures accessibility for all passengers. Step-free access helps those with mobility issues reach platforms without trouble though some areas may still pose challenges due to the stepped footbridge. Assistance is available during staffed hours, or through advance Passenger Assist bookings for added support. Although there are no accessible toilets, the station is committed to providing a welcoming environment for all travelers with several accessible parking spaces available. If you need help, customer information, departure screens, and help points are available to assist you.
Not only is the station your gateway to the local area, but it also offers various onward travel connections. Rail replacement services can pick you up or drop you off at the bus stop atop the station approach road. While taxi services may be limited, the CAB4YOU service might be useful. An array of bus services complements the rail network; a quick call to Busline at 0871 200 2233 can provide information on schedules and routes. Despite the lack of on-site bicycle hire, secure and sheltered storage is available for those bringing their bikes.
